It uses the existing ``groupListRemove`` API call. + + +**Query builds per chunks in prune-signed-builds**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1589 + +For bigger installations querying all builds can cause the hub to run out of memory. +``prune-signed-builds`` now queries these in 50k chunks. + + +**Show inheritance flags in list-tag-inheritance output**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1120 + +While not often used, tag inheritance can be modified with a few different options (e.g. maxdepth). +These options are shown in the ``taginfo`` display, but not the ``list-tag-inheritance`` display. +This change adds basic indicators to the latter. + + +**Return usage information in make-task**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1157 + +``make-task`` now returns usage information if no arguments are provided. + + +**Clarify clone-tag usage**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1623 + +The ``clone-tag`` help text now clarifies that the destination tag will be created +if it does not already exist. + + +**Add option check for list-signed**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1631 + +The ``list-signed`` command will now fail if no options are provided. + + + +Library Changes +--------------- + +**Consolidate config reading style**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1296 + +Changes have been made to make configuration handling more consistent. + +With this new implementation: + +* ``read_config_files`` is extended with a strict option and directory support +* ``ConfigParser`` is used for all invokings except kojixmlrpc and ``kojid`` +* ``RawConfigParser`` is used for ``kojid`` + + +**list_archive_files handles multi-type builds**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1508 + +If ``list_archive_files`` is provided a build with multiple archive types it now correctly +handles them instead of failing. + + +**Disallow archive imports that don't match build type**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1627 +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1633 + +The ``importArchive`` call now refuses to proceed if the build does not have the given type. + + +**Add listCG RPC**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1160 + +``listCGs`` has been added to list new content generator records. + +The purpose of this change is to make it easier for administrators to determine what +content generators are present and what user accounts have access to those. + + +**Add method to cancel CG reservations**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1662 + +The new ``CGRefundBuild`` call allows CGs to cancel build reservations, such as in the case +of a failing build. + + +**Allow ClientSession objects to get cleaned up by the garbage collector**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1653 + +This change ensures ``koji.ClientSession`` objects are destroyed once their requests are complete. + + +**Add missing package list check**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1244 +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1702 + +The ``host.tagBuild`` method was missing a check to ensure the package was actually listed in the +destination tag. This should now be checked as expected. + + +**Increase buildReferences SQL performance**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1675 + +The performance for ``build_references`` has been improved. + + +**ensuredir does not duplicate directories**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1197 + +``koji.ensuredir`` no longer creates duplicate directories if provided a path ending in a +forward slash. + + +**Warn users if buildroot uses yum instead of dnf**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1595 + +This change sets the mock config ``dnf_warning`` to True for buildroots using yum. + + +**Tag permission can be used for tagBuildBypass and untagBuildBypass**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1685 + +The ``tag`` permission can now be used in place of admin to call ``tagBuildBypass`` +and ``untagBuildBypass``. Admin is still required to use the ``--force`` option. + + +**Rework update of reserved builds**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1621 + +This change reworks and simplifies the code that updates reserved build entries for cg imports. +It removes redundancy with checks in ``prep_build`` and avoids duplicate ``*BuildStateChange`` +callbacks. + + +**Use correct top limit for randint**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1612 + +The top limit for ``randint`` has been set to 255 from 256 to prevent ``generate_token`` from +creating unneccesarily long tokens. + + +**Add strict option to getRPMFile**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1068 + +``getRPMFile`` now has a ``strict`` option, failing when the RPM or filename does not exist. + + +**Stricter groupListRemove**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1173 +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1678 + +``groupListRemove`` now returns an error if the provided group does not exist for the tag. + + +**Clarified docs for build.extra.source**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1677 + +The usage for ``build.extra.source`` has now been clarified in the ``getBuild`` call. + + +**Use bytes for debug string**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1657 + +This change fixes debug output for Python 3. + + +**Removed host.repoAddRPM call**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1680 + +The ``host.repoAddRPM`` call has been removed because it was unused and broken. + + + +Web UI Changes +-------------- + +**Made difference between Builds and Tags sections more clear**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1676 + +The search page results for packages now has a clearer delineation between builds and tags. + + + +Builder Changes +--------------- + +**Use preferred arch when builder provides multiple**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1684 + +When using ExclusiveArch for noarch builds the build task will now use the +arch specified instead of randomly picking from the arches the builder provides. + +This change adds a ``preferred_arch`` parameter to ``find_arch``. + + +**Log insufficient disk space location**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1523 + +When ``kojid`` fails due to insufficient disk space, the directory which needs more +disk space is now included as part of the log message. + + +**Allow builder to attempt krb if gssapi is available**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1613 + +``kojid`` will now use ``requests_kebreros`` for kerberos authentication when available. + + +**Add support for new mock exit codes**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1682 + +``kojid`` now expects mock exit code 10 for failed builds (previously 1). + + +**Fix kickstart uploads for Python 3**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1618 + +This change fixes the file handling of kickstarts for Python 3. + + + +System Changes +-------------- + +**Package ownership changes do not trigger repo regens**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1473 +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1643 + +Changing tag or package owners no longer cause repo regeneration. A new +``tag_package_owners`` table has been added for this purpose. + + +**Support multiple realms by kerberos auth** + +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1648 +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1696 +| PR: https://pagure.io/koji/pull-request/1701 + +This change adds a new table ``user_krb_principals`` which tracks a list of ``krb_principals`` +for each user instead of the previous one-to-one mapping.
